This full-time position will have you working school hours from 7:45 a.m. to 3:45 p.m., Monday through Friday, serving as a vital bridge for a 4th-grade student excited to embark on their ASL journey. You'll gain invaluable experience in educational settings and grow your resume with unique responsibilities, all while maintaining an engaging work-life balance that lets you explore local culture, nature, and dining in your free time.
Qualifications:
Licensed with the Kansas Commission on Deaf/Hard of Hearing (KCDHH) Proficient in American Sign Language (ASL) Previous experience in school environments preferred Patience, adaptability, and strong communication skills
Responsibilities:
Provide one-on-one sign language interpretation for a 4th-grade student new to ASL Collaborate closely with classroom teachers and related service providers Support the student's learning, social integration, and participation in school activities Maintain confidentiality and uphold ethical standards in interpreting Potential to extend assignment for Extended School Year (ESY) services
